1. What color is there?

1. What are the colors?

Carnation is a very common flower. It comes in many colors. The more common ones are red, white, pink, peach, dark red, yellow, beige, Purple, light yellow. In addition, some flowers are striped in color, and some are spotted. It is a very suitable flower to give to elders, and people like to give it to their mothers.

2. Meaning

Different colors of flowers represent different meanings. Red generally represents passionate love and can be used to symbolize love or express love for your mother. White represents purity and respect. People usually give it to female friends or their best friends. Yellow also represents gratitude, which in love represents disappointment and rejection, so don’t give it to your lover casually.

3. Growth Habits

1 . Light-loving: It likes sunlight because it is a plant that is exposed to medium sunlight. In normal times, it should receive as much light as possible, especially during the flowering period, it should be exposed to more light, which has a lot of influence on its flower color and flower size.

2. Likes coolness: It likes to grow in a cool environment and cannot tolerate heat. When the temperature of the curing environment is higher than 35°C, its growth will become very slow, and it is necessary to cool down at this time. In winter, the temperature should be kept above 9℃. If you keep it at home, you need to enter the house in winter.
